Beware of lead thieves, police warn

POLICE are warning residents in a Kent town to be alert for lead thieves following a spate of incidents.

Several homes in the Maidstone area have had lead stolen from their roofs in the last few weeks.

In the latest incident, a home in Kennington Close had lead pulled away from the brickwork on the porch between February 22 and February 25.

Earlier this month, a home in Graveney Road had lead removed from the roof in similar circumstances.

Anyone with information about these or any other lead theft is asked to contact police on 01622 690055 or call Kent Crimestoppers on 0800 555111.
